INTM331015 | Double Taxation applications and claims: Repayment claims from non-residents: The key stages with legislative references

From HM Revenue & Customs · International Manual

There are a number of key stages in the self assessment process, some of which have strict time limits. This paragraph lists those stages together with references to the appropriate paragraph of TMA70/SCH1A. Paragraph INTM331016 explains what the “Process now -check later system” means for double taxation claims to HMRC. Paragraphs INTM331017 to INTM331023 give an outline for each stage, including any applicable time limits. A full procedural guide for each stage is available at INTM331050 to INTM331400.
